Massachusetts is made for nature lovers, especially hikers. One of the best things about hiking in the state is you’ll find a trail whether you want a short and sweet experience or you want to spend an entire day exploring all that Massachusetts has to offer. The Cape Cod Rail Trail in Massachusetts, for example, just might be the perfect trail. You can hike it in sections or tackle it all in a single day.
